diff options
author | StapleButter <thetotalworm@gmail.com> | 2017-06-09 15:11:39 +0200 |
---|---|---|
committer | StapleButter <thetotalworm@gmail.com> | 2017-06-09 15:11:39 +0200 |
commit | 9852709ca350bf541a8f595fd68c90d1ef540aea (patch) | |
tree | c52c6989bd1125e7b0b002cdf96c4ce9a228e3a5 /src/wx | |
parent | 0f827337c837b5d7eec32d8df4eabbacca129ee9 (diff) |
wifi: attempt at further MP functionality (reply, ack). not working. ugly.
Diffstat (limited to 'src/wx')
-rw-r--r-- | src/wx/Platform.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/wx/Platform.cpp b/src/wx/Platform.cpp index 4a60184..4085420 100644 --- a/src/wx/Platform.cpp +++ b/src/wx/Platform.cpp @@ -154,7 +154,7 @@ bool MP_Init() sockaddr_t saddr; saddr.sa_family = AF_INET; - *(u32*)&saddr.sa_data[2] = htonl(INADDR_ANY); + *(u32*)&saddr.sa_data[2] = htonl(INADDR_LOOPBACK);//htonl(INADDR_ANY); *(u16*)&saddr.sa_data[0] = htons(7064); res = bind(MPSocket, &saddr, sizeof(sockaddr_t)); if (res < 0) @@ -222,7 +222,7 @@ int MP_RecvPacket(u8* data, bool block) FD_ZERO(&fd); FD_SET(MPSocket, &fd); tv.tv_sec = 0; - tv.tv_usec = 0; + tv.tv_usec = block ? 5000 : 0; if (!select(MPSocket+1, &fd, 0, 0, &tv)) { |